8876613dc5
if not already defined. This allows building libc from outside of lib/libc using a reach-over makefile. A typical use-case is to build a standard ILP32 version and a COMPAT32 version in a single iteration by building the COMPAT32 version using a reach-over makefile. Obtained from: Juniper Networks, Inc.
25 lines
643 B
Makefile
25 lines
643 B
Makefile
# $FreeBSD$
|
|
|
|
# DCE 1.1 UUID implementation sources
|
|
|
|
.PATH: ${LIBC_SRCTOP}/uuid
|
|
|
|
SRCS+= uuid_compare.c uuid_create.c uuid_create_nil.c uuid_equal.c \
|
|
uuid_from_string.c uuid_hash.c uuid_is_nil.c uuid_stream.c \
|
|
uuid_to_string.c
|
|
SYM_MAPS+= ${LIBC_SRCTOP}/uuid/Symbol.map
|
|
|
|
MAN+= uuid.3
|
|
MLINKS+=uuid.3 uuid_compare.3
|
|
MLINKS+=uuid.3 uuid_create.3
|
|
MLINKS+=uuid.3 uuid_create_nil.3
|
|
MLINKS+=uuid.3 uuid_equal.3
|
|
MLINKS+=uuid.3 uuid_from_string.3
|
|
MLINKS+=uuid.3 uuid_hash.3
|
|
MLINKS+=uuid.3 uuid_is_nil.3
|
|
MLINKS+=uuid.3 uuid_enc_le.3
|
|
MLINKS+=uuid.3 uuid_dec_le.3
|
|
MLINKS+=uuid.3 uuid_enc_be.3
|
|
MLINKS+=uuid.3 uuid_dec_be.3
|
|
MLINKS+=uuid.3 uuid_to_string.3
|